Dayana Shamara Trajano Ricardo Lopes is a Brazilian footballer who plays as a defender.
In March 2026, Internacional confirmed that Eskerdinha suffered an ACL and meniscus injury in her right knee during a Brasileirão Feminino match against Atlético-MG.
“Eskerdinha” comes from the Portuguese word esquerda (“left”), a reference to her role as a left-sided player/full-back. The playful “-inha” ending makes it roughly translate to “little lefty.”
She left home at a young age to pursue football and later said the pandemic was one of the rare moments she could spend extended time with her mother and grandmother again.
Her pet chow-chow is named Yuri.
She spent seven years playing futsal before fully transitioning to outdoor football. She has spoken about how futsal taught her improvisation and close control in tight spaces before moving into 11-a-side football.
